Brad Pitt says he needed ‘rebooting' after divorce with Angelina Jolie, recalls joining Alcoholics Anonymous to cope with alcohol addiction

Actor Brad Pitt has hardly ever been the one to mince his words about his personal life, career and any other episodes that take place in his life. The actor has talked about his long, drawn-out divorce with Angelina Jolie on multiple occasions, and for the most part, he has downplayed the entire separation. While promoting his upcoming film F1, the actor talked about the challenges he faced with alcohol addiction and how AA (Alcoholics Anonymous) helped him immensely after his divorce.
While talking to fellow actor Dax Shepard on his podcast, Pitt revealed how AA was a game changer for him, and when asked about whether he was comfortable talking about it, Pitt was very open and honest about how he and Dax actually met and bonded with each other for the first time. 'Actually I am quite at ease, not nervous at all. It was a men's group, and it was my first time getting sober, and I just thought there was an incredible level of 'sharing' – listening to people's experiences, their foibles, missteps, wants and aches – and there was a lot of humour with it. Coming from the background or situations I have been raised in, where you just pretend like everything is okay, it was a great feeling. I just needed to reboot, and wake up.'

Pitt appreciated Dax and how he made him feel during those AA meetings and said, 'He would usually be the last person to share, and he was like the elder statesman of the meeting. I just remember him identifying the theme of the evening and just telling his story in the funniest way possible, and that meant a lot to me.' Many fans reacted to Pitt's openness about his challenges with addiction and showed their appreciation and support for the actor in the comments. One user commented, 'Dax and Brad being AA bf's is my absolute favourite thing in the world,' while another user said how he shared this video with a relative of theirs who was also in recovery. Pitt and Jolie got married in 2014, and they filed for divorce in 2019. Divorce settlements finally came to an end in 2024.

Coming to his career, Pitt is currently waiting for the global release of this upcoming sports drama, F1, where he will play the role of racing veteran Sonny Hayes, who returns to Formula One in order to save his old teammates racing team. Actor Tom Cruise, who had talked about Pitt's driving skills and expressed his excitement for the movie, showed up to the premiere of the film and reunited with Pitt after almost 24 years. The duo posed with director Joseph Kosinski, who is responsible for both Pitt's F1 and Cruise's Top Gun: Maverick. Seeing the positive early reviews from the critics and the press, Pitt and company will be hoping to achieve a successful theatrical run after the movie released on June 27.
Helmed by Kosinski, the film features Pitt, Javier Bardem, Damson Idris, Kerry Condon, Lewis Hamilton, and several other real-life F1 drivers.

‘She slayed with grace': Internet roots for Simone Ashley for showing up at F1 premiere despite being cut from film

Jun 24, 2025 04:17 PM IST British-Indian actor Simone Ashley had a key role in the sports drama F1, which was billed as her big break in Hollywood. Unfortunately, her role was edited out completely from the final edit of the film, as confirmed by director Joseph Kosinski. The actor proudly stepped out at the F1: The Movie premiere in London on Monday to show her support. What did Brad Pitt do to look fit for F1? Director Joseph Kosinski answers

Brad Pitt plays the lead role in Joseph Kosinski's latest film 'F1', which follows a race car driver getting a second chance at victory. At 61, Brad is looking his best and had to maintain peak physical fitness for the film, in which he drives the race car an exclusive chat with India Today, Joesph Kosinski, the director of 'F1', revealed how Brad Pitt stayed fit during the shoot. Joseph said, 'You know he obviously takes care of himself. He is in incredible shape and that was really useful to this film because driving these cars is so physically gruelling. You have to be an athlete to be able to do it, you know, hour after hour to get in the car and shoot these rigorous scenes. And sometimes, you know, we would be shooting eight or ten hours a day in these cars. So, yes, it was physically demanding.'Adding that Brad did the driving himself, Joseph continued, 'Brad also has a real natural ability with driving. I couldn't have made this film if he hadn't been able to do that. And even Lewis Hamilton, who is also a co-producer on the film, was really impressed with Brad's athletic ability.'READ F1 REVIEW HEREJoseph has also directed 'Top Gun Maverick' with Tom Cruise. Having worked with the two biggest actors in the world, he spoke about the similarities between them and the differences. He revealed, 'I think they're more similar than people would realise. They are both great actors, obviously. They both work very hard and are very focus on every detail of the filmmaking process. They are both obviously very involved in the script all the way to the final edit. You know, on the outside, maybe Brad seems a little more relaxed and chilled out, but he's just as driven as Tom is and wants to deliver the best experience for an audience.' F1 will hit theatres in India on June 27.- Ends

Ahead of F1, Brad Pitt calls this former co-star ‘annoyingly good' at racing: ‘He is just a natural at everything he does'

With F1 the movie right around the corner, actor Brad Pitt has put the pedal to the metal when it comes to promotions. Pitt, who isn't really known for giving long interviews, let alone making appearances on a podcast, showed up on actor Dave Shepard's show The Armchair Expert. Pitt touched on several topics, including addiction, recovery, F1, early career and future plans. But what Brad was most excited about was his love for motor sports in general, and he shared several anecdotes about his racing hobby, including one of racing bikes with actor Channing Tatum. Pitt and Dave can be seen completely digressing from what they were talking about, as they both started 'nerding out' about racing and how Pitt very graciously offered to fly Dave to the last racing event they had. Dave said, 'I remember you suddenly asking me after an AA meeting whether I was going to the tracks or not, and then you offered to fly me there in your helicopter.' Pitt dodged the compliment and said that he is glad that he gets to do 'rock and roll' things like that once in a while. ALSO READ: F1 first reviews out: Brad Pitt's film gets 85% score on Rotten Tomatoes, critics celebrate its 'high speed splendour' He then turned the tables and said, 'Let it be known that Dave is rapid; he is very quick on the bike. I wasn't as quick as some of these guys, like Channing.' To which Dave said, 'Let the record also reflect that Brad is also very quick and Channing was just annoyingly good very quickly. He is just one of those athletes who can do everything and is just a natural.' The duo also talked about Toto Wolff, who is the CEO of Mercedes's Formula One team, and how he talks about Lewis Hamilton also being a natural at everything he does. It's definitely high praise, coming from someone like Pitt, who has actually driven an F1 car and has been appreciated for his racing skills by the one and only Tom Cruise. During the CinemaCon earlier this year, Cruise expressed his excitement for F1 and recalled working with Pitt on the movie Interview With The Vampire (1994). 'It's great to see Brad driving; he's a very good driver, believe me. I have raced against him. When we were doing Interview With The Vampire, we used to go and race go-karts against each other. We would finish and then go race go-karts all night, and he was a hell of a driver.' It seems that Pitt will get to see more of Channing on the motorbike, as the duo are reportedly collaborating on a docu-series about one of the most dangerous races of all time, the Isle of Man TT. F1 has been directed by Joseph Kosinski, and the cast includes Pitt, Javier Bardem, Damson Idris, Kerry Condon and Lewis Hamilton. Pitt will play the role of a veteran driver who returns to Formula One and teams up with a rookie (Idris) to save his old friend's (Bardem) team. The film also features music from aristes like Ed Sheeran, BLACKPINK, Chris Stapleton, Doja Cat and more. It releases worldwide on June 27.
